Police From Several Area Departments Collaborate, Charge Man with Burglary
Egg Harbor man was charged with breaking into parked cars.
A 28-year-old Egg Harbor man has been arrested and charged with burglary in Harvey Cedars, police said.
On Oct. 20, 2012, around 2:20 PM, Harvey Cedars police responded to Sunset Park for a report of a male breaking into parked cars. Once on scene, police said they were met by an off-duty Stafford Township patrolman who had witnessed one of the break-ins.
Officers searched the area and found the suspect, Brendan K. Meter, on the beach at Hudson Avenue.
He was arrested by Officer Christopher Oldham and was assisted by Officer Sean Ferguson of Long Beach Township police. Meter was charged with burglary and has a court date in November.
